Abstract

backgroundDiabetic nephropathy (DN) is the primary microvascular complication of diabetes mellitus (DM), contributing to chronic kidney disease, and end-stage renal failure. More than 247,000 individuals develop renal failure due to DM. Mediterranean diet (MD) associated with cardiometabolic benefits and potential renal protective effects, however, its relationship on the onset and progression of DN remains unclear.

objectiveTo examine the association between adherence to the MD and the onset and progression of DN.

methodsThis systematic review was conducted in accordance with PRISMA 2020 guidelines. A comprehensive search was performed in PUBMED, EBSCO host and SCOPUS databases. Studies including adults with hyperglycemia, DM, or DN, regardless of comorbidities, examining adherence to the MD and renal outcomes. Methodological integrity was evaluated using the Newcastle-Ottawa Scale (NOS) and Jadad Scale. Due to heterogeneity across studies, results were synthesized narratively.

resultsSix studies met the inclusion criteria. Most studies demonstrated that higher adherence to the MD was associated with a lower risk or odds of DN, particularly among individuals with DM. Reported associations ranged from 21% to 86%, depending on adherence level and study design. Two studies found no statistically significant associations ( LIMITATIONS: The small number of studies, their predominantly observational design, and geographic concentration limit the generalizability and preclude causal inference.

conclusionHigher adherence to the MD appears to be associated with a lower risk of DN; however, current evidence remains limited and insufficient to draw conclusions regarding causality or disease progression. Further high-quality studies are required.
